Men's Volleyball Falls In Three Sets To Division I St. Francis (Pa.)

Mount Olive suffered its first three-set loss of the season, falling to Division I Saint Francis (Pa.) 25-19, 25-15, 25-19 in non-conference men's volleyball Friday at Loretto, Pa. The loss was only the Trojans' second of the season, both against Division I opponents.

In the opening set, Mount Olive (6-2) and Saint Francis (3-6) went back and forth in the early going. Ben Casado assisted on kills by Andreas Lengler and Lewis Einarson as the Trojans pulled even 5-5. But the Red Flash answered with kills by Logan Patterson, Collin Sherwood and Mike Marshman to take command.

Two attack errors by Mount Olive and a kill from Kyle Beatty extended St. Francis' lead to 15-9. The lead was seven when Mount Olive mounted a rally late. Lengler, Adam Miracle and Angel Dache delivered kills during a 4-1 run that got Mount Olive within four. It got no closer.

In game two, the Trojans fell behind at the outset. St. Francis raced out to a 6-0 lead thanks to Adam Roche, Patterson and an ace by Colin Sherwin. Five times in the set, Mount Olive got as close as four.

In the clincher, St. Francis used a 5-1 run to build a 10-4 lead, then held off Mount Olive's attempt at a comeback.

Miracle led the Trojans with nine kills and six digs. Dache and Lengler each added six kills, while Casado had 10 assists.

Last year at Kornegay Arena, Mount Olive defeated Saint Francis in five sets for the Trojans' third win overall against a Division I opponent and first win at home. Mount Olive posted a pair of wins over Harvard in 2008.

Mount Olive's only other loss this season came against Division I Ball State as the Trojans battled the Cardinals to four sets.
